GPS Troubleshooting

1. No reading

Make sure the GPS is plugged in.

Please make sure the GPS is installed by checking the device manager under the sensor group. u-blox should appear as a sensor. If the GPS was not installed, try to install the GPS following the installation guide.

Also check "Location privacy settings" in Windows settings. Location function must be turned on and open to 3rd party apps.

To test if the GPS is successfully installed, download the u-center software and check if u-center can successfully read the GPS data

If it still doesn't work, go to the device manager, find the sensor driver and right click on it to check if there's any power saving mode turned on. Turn off all power saving related settings.

2. Low accuracy

If the GPS accuracy is consistently showing over 50 meters while being outside, there may be a problem with GPS hardware or driver.  Please make sure the GPS hardware is properly installed. When the GPS starts working, it typically shows an accuracy less than 10 meters.  It can take up to five minutes for GPS reading to show high accuracy when a new GPS starts to work.
